jQuery 运行 CSS 动画:入门指南
作为一名资深开发者,我很高兴能分享一些关于如何使用 jQuery 来运行 CSS 动画的基础知识。CSS 动画是一种非常流行的网页设计技术,它可以使网页元素在视觉上更加生动和吸引人。而 jQuery,作为一种快速、小巧且功能丰富的 JavaScript 库,可以极大地简化我们实现这些动画的过程。
动画实现流程
首先,让我们通过一个简单的流程表来了解实现 CSS 动画的步骤:
步骤 | 描述 | 代码示例 |
---|---|---|
1 | 引入 jQuery 库 | `<script src=" |
2 | 编写 CSS 动画样式 | @keyframes rotate { from { transform: rotate(0deg); } to { transform: rotate(360deg); } } |
3 | 为元素添加动画类 | <div id="animatedElement" class="initialClass"></div> |
4 | 使用 jQuery 添加动画 | $('#animatedElement').addClass('animated rotate'); |
5 | 触发动画 | 使用 jQuery 触发动画效果 |
详细步骤解析
步骤 1: 引入 jQuery 库
首先,我们需要在 HTML 文件中引入 jQuery 库。你可以使用以下代码将 jQuery 库添加到你的项目中:
<script src="
步骤 2: 编写 CSS 动画样式
接下来,我们需要定义 CSS 动画。这里是一个简单的旋转动画的例子:
@keyframes rotate {
from {
transform: rotate(0deg);
}
to {
transform: rotate(360deg);
}
}
步骤 3: 为元素添加动画类
在 HTML 中,我们需要为想要添加动画的元素指定一个类名,以便我们稍后使用 jQuery 来引用它:
<div id="animatedElement" class="initialClass"></div>
步骤 4: 使用 jQuery 添加动画
现在,我们使用 jQuery 来为元素添加动画。首先,我们给元素添加一个 animated
类,然后添加我们之前定义的动画类 rotate
:
$('#animatedElement').addClass('animated rotate');
步骤 5: 触发动画
最后,我们需要触发动画。这可以通过多种方式实现,例如点击按钮、页面加载完成等。这里是一个示例,当页面加载完成后触发动画:
$(document).ready(function() {
$('#animatedElement').addClass('animated rotate');
});
饼状图展示动画使用频率
使用 Mermaid 语法,我们可以创建一个饼状图来展示不同动画类型的使用频率:
pie
title 动画使用频率
"旋转" : 45
"淡入淡出" : 25
"滑动" : 20
"缩放" : 10
结语
通过上述步骤,你应该能够使用 jQuery 来运行 CSS 动画了。记住,实践是学习的最佳方式,所以不要害怕尝试和修改代码。随着经验的积累,你将能够更熟练地使用 jQuery 和 CSS 动画来增强你的网页设计。祝你编程愉快!